PACE Services (Community Colleges of Spokane)

PACE (People Accessing Careers and Education) Services assists people with significant obstacles to employment or community inclusion to achieve life goals through education, resource coordination and vocational support. Most of our students have cognitive, physical, sensory or psychiatric disabilities and we want to see them achieve independence, employment and ongoing education. PACE Services is a non credit program through the Community Colleges of Spokane that provides employment and educational services to individuals with significant barriers to their life goals. Individuals have the opportunity to take classes that will increase their knowledge to successful employment and/or independent living.
